Sacramento, CA – With a 2:00pm start time the field warmed up nicely from the earlier Women's Soccer Championship. Mt. SAC came into the game as the 4-time defending State Champions.
In the 1st half of the game, both teams had minimal scoring opportunities. Hartnell had a couple of scoring chances which they were unable to convert. Mt. SAC had their scoring opportunities nullified by offside calls.
In the 2nd half Hartnell controlled the ball which is shown by the number of corners (6) and shots (9) in the 2nd half. The only goal of the game came off a corner kick by Lorenzo Vasquez with a header from the far post put into the net by Joni Cruz. Hartnell's great defense was shown throughout the game holding Mt. SAC to no shots on goal though Goal Keeper Fabian Narez was able to come out of his box to clear out some over-passes by Mt. SAC.
This victory by Hartnell was their 1st CCCAA Men's Soccer Championship for the Panthers. The MVP of the CCCAA Men's Final four was Hartnell's #10 Joni Cruz.
